Pete Correale Charleston Music Hall Tickets & Info
Experience a night of side-splitting comedy with Pete Correale in Charleston on October 25, 2025. Known for his sharp wit and relatable humor, Pete Correale has been a staple of the New York comedy scene and gained national recognition through his appearance on Comedy Central's 'Comedy Central Presents' in 2004. His comedic style often explores themes of family, relationships, and everyday life, resonating deeply with diverse audiences. In 2011, he released his acclaimed comedy special 'Let Me Tell Ya,' which highlights his unique storytelling and improvisational skills. Having performed regularly in Las Vegas, Pete has captivated both tourists and locals alike, often engaging with the audience for spontaneous, memorable moments. Seating Sections & Views
- Section A: Front and center, Rows 2-4, closest to stage, most direct views, higher prices.
- Section H: Elevated front rows (Rows 1-3), offering an angled view with good sightlines, more affordable than front-row A seats.
- Section REARD & REARH: Rear balcony sections, Rows 13-14 (REARD) and 5-9 (REARH), providing a higher-up perspective, best for budget options.
- Views: Front sections offer direct, unobstructed views; mid-sections balance view and price; rear balcony offers elevation but a more distant perspective.
